Day 1-3: Arrival and Exploring Ahmedabad

Begin your family adventure in Ahmedabad, the state's cosmopolitan hub. Marvel at the Sabarmati Ashram, where Mahatma Gandhi once lived, and educate your kids about India's fight for independence. Don't miss the Calico Museum of Textiles, which showcases the region's textile history, and the intriguing Adalaj Stepwell. A fun-filled evening awaits at Kankaria Lake, where attractions include a zoo, toy trains, and a water park.

Day 4-5: Heritage of Vadodara

Next, travel to Vadodara to witness the regal splendor of the Laxmi Vilas Palace and step back in time at the Maharaja Fateh Singh Museum. You can also experience tranquility at Sursagar Lake and visit nearby Pavagadh Archaeological Park.

Day 6-7: Temples and Beaches of Dwarka and Somnath

Head to the sacred city of Dwarka, which is believed to be the ancient kingdom of Lord Krishna. Visit the Dwarkadhish Temple and take a dip in the Gomti River. The journey continues to Somnath, where the mesmerizing Somnath Temple by the Arabian Sea awaits you.

Day 8-9: Adventures in Gir and Diu

Experience the thrill of wildlife at Gir National Park by taking a safari and spotting the majestic Asiatic lions. After exploring the wild, unwind at the peaceful beaches of Diu, perfect for relaxing with your family.

Day 10: Arts and Crafts of Bhuj

Your trip wouldn't be complete without a visit to Bhuj, known for its handicrafts and embroidery. Engage in local art workshops and revel in the beauty of the Aina Mahal.

Day 11-12: Cultural Excursions to Rann of Kutch

Wind up your journey at the Rann of Kutch, a spectacular white salt desert. Plan your visit during the Rann Utsav for cultural performances, camel rides, and a chance to stay in traditional tents. The Kutch Museum and the Wild Ass Sanctuary are also must-visits.

Best Time to Visit Gujarat

The ideal time to book Gujarat Family Tour Packages From Dumka is during the cooler months of November to February when the weather is pleasant for sightseeing and outdoor activities. Summer months (March to June) can be extremely hot, making daytime excursions uncomfortable. Monsoon season (July to September) brings respite from the heat but might restrict movement due to heavy rainfall.
